Oracle text

Instant

Target opponent looks at the top four cards of your library and separates them into a face-down pile and a face-up pile. Put one pile into your hand and the other into your graveyard.

Rulings
  • WotCJul 13, 2016

    A pile can have no cards in it. In this case, you’ll choose whether to put all the cards into your hand or into your graveyard.

  • WotCJul 13, 2016

    In a multiplayer game, the targeted opponent may choose what information to share with others if that player wants advice on how to split the cards, but that player doesn’t have to share any information at all.

  • WotCJul 13, 2016

    You choose which pile to put into your hand and which to put into your graveyard. You can’t look at the face-down pile until after it’s moving to its new zone.
